You may have a wiring issue- perhaps run an extra ground wire to the OBC and see if it comes back to life. Suspect any non-factory wiring work local to the OBC wiring. Check the fusible link jic. If you get it going again, run it in diagnostics mode and keep a watch on the system voltage whilst driving, in case it happens again- that could be a clue. Nick
